The Scandal of Being Female

A heartbreaking story of love and loss; of dreams and unexpected realities; of scandal and unintended consequences that ripple through three generations.

When Iris Hughes, a talented, determined young woman and mother of two, leaves her unfulfilling marriage to pursue her dreams, she walks directly into the strangling restrictions of the 1940's male-dominated culture and is ultimately thrown into scandal due to an improbable and unintended pregnancy. With the help of a few encouraging women, she strives to protect and promote her vulnerable daughters within an unsupportive, sometimes hostile society.

After Iris's illegitimate daughter, Ellie, learns the truth of her paternity, she begins to explore the impact of her mother's experiences on her own life as well as those of her older sisters, unraveling family secrets, and watching in disbelief as the impact continues to unfold-threatening to tear the family apart.
